Alan Simpson is a software consultant, best–selling author, and teacher who has been active in the computer industry for over two decades. His books include dozens of popularly, critically, and technically acclaimed titles.
Celeste Robinson has worked as a systems engineer, small business consultant, technical trainer, and database developer in a computing career that spans more than twenty years.
Simpson and Robinson worked together on Mastering Access 97, Mastering Paradox 7, and Mastering WordPerfect Office 2000, all from Sybex.
